brokerhorst
Grünschnabel
Hallo Leute,
ich erstelle in einer onClick Methode einen Frame...etwa so:
wenn ich jetzt den Frame schließe, erkennt dann der gc, dass er die Instanz löschen kann oder muss ich da noch was machen?...weil wenn die onClick Methode fertig ist, is die Instanz ja noch da...sonst würd ich ja das fenster nicht sehen...deshalb frage ich mich, ob ich mir so nach und nach den speicher vollmülle.
ich will das man bei mehreren klicks mehrere Fenster aufmachen kann, deshalb hab ich keine globale instanz für den frame angelegt.
lg
Andre
ich erstelle in einer onClick Methode einen Frame...etwa so:
Code:
@Override
public void mouseClicked ( final MouseEvent arg0 ) {
if (arg0.getClickCount () == 2) {
ResultView rv = new ResultView();
rv.setVisible(true);
}
}
wenn ich jetzt den Frame schließe, erkennt dann der gc, dass er die Instanz löschen kann oder muss ich da noch was machen?...weil wenn die onClick Methode fertig ist, is die Instanz ja noch da...sonst würd ich ja das fenster nicht sehen...deshalb frage ich mich, ob ich mir so nach und nach den speicher vollmülle.
ich will das man bei mehreren klicks mehrere Fenster aufmachen kann, deshalb hab ich keine globale instanz für den frame angelegt.
lg
Andre